Features

Two-Way High Performance Audio Loudspeakers with 3/4" Neodymium Silk Tweeter and 4" Long-Throw and High-Gauss Woofer

Vented Tuned Port Type with Bass Extension Down to 65Hz

Goldplated Terminals, Accepting High Performance Speaker Cables up to 10 AWG / 4mm2

Acoustically Optimized Aluminum Front Grille. Always Stable Three Feet Foundation

Tuned and Optimized for Excellent Music Reproduction with High Performance

Amplifiers and Hi-Fi Equipment

Special Matching Design and Size with Linksys by Cisco Director (DMC250)

Specifications

Model

DMSPK50

Main Functions

Two Way Bass-Reflex Loudspeaker

Frequency Range

-6dB at 65Hz and 23kHz

Frequency Response

80Hz-20kHz +/-3dB

Crossover Frequency

3kHz. 2’nd Order LPF. 2’nd Order HPF

Sensitivity

85dB SPL (2.83V in 1meter/3’)

Nominal Impedance

6 Ohm

Minimum Impedance

4.6 Ohm

Max Power Handling

50 Watt

Recommended

 

Amplifier Output Power

20W to 50W

Terminals

Gold Plated for up to 10 AWG / 4mm2 Speaker Cable

Front grille

Perforated Aluminum Front

Finish

Black Enclosure. Natural Anodized Front Grill

Placement

On Stand or Shelf (Minimum 5 cm / 2" from Back Wall)
